Create a New Scenario to Connect Campaign Monitor and Calendly
In the workspace, click the βCreate New Scenarioβ button.
Add the First Step
Add the first node β a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a Campaign Monitor,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, Campaign Monitor or Calendly will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find Campaign Monitor or Calendly,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Save and Activate the Scenario
After configuring Campaign Monitor, Calendly, and any additional nodes, donβt for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.
Test the Scenario
Run the scenario by clicking βRun onceβ and triggering an event to check if the Campaign Monitor and Calendly integ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between Campaign Monitor and Calendly (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.
